Genesis 24:46-48
Living Bible
46 She quickly lifted the jug down from her shoulder so that I could drink, and told me, ‘Certainly, sir, and I will water your camels too!’ So she did! 47 Then I asked her, ‘Whose family are you from?’ And she told me, ‘Nahor’s. My father is Bethuel, the son of Nahor and his wife Milcah.’ So I gave her the ring and the bracelets. 48 Then I bowed my head and worshiped and blessed Jehovah, the God of my master Abraham, because he had led me along just the right path to find a girl from the family of my master’s brother.[a]

Genesis 24:46-48
New International Version
46 “She quickly lowered her jar from her shoulder and said, ‘Drink, and I’ll water your camels too.’(A) So I drank, and she watered the camels also.(B)
47 “I asked her, ‘Whose daughter are you?’(C)
“She said, ‘The daughter of Bethuel(D) son of Nahor, whom Milkah bore to him.’(E)
“Then I put the ring in her nose(F) and the bracelets on her arms,(G) 48 and I bowed down and worshiped the Lord.(H) I praised the Lord, the God of my master Abraham,(I) who had led me on the right road to get the granddaughter of my master’s brother for his son.(J)
